Transaction f856f32cd462872e1841ed0a87eebb40bc6f75faa343f0b9d21a31daf396a4e3

1 Input
2 Outputs
  • f856f32cd462872e1841ed0a87eebb40bc6f75faa343f0b9d21a31daf396a4e3:0
  • value  552306057
    address  129cGX9DNXCZdqugTXsQXYNNKkHxgVFhNp
  • f856f32cd462872e1841ed0a87eebb40bc6f75faa343f0b9d21a31daf396a4e3:1
  • value  13967987
    address  18gcrtJrfuGbA7K56rZUhArZuqf6gPyMSJ